Types of Free Forex Signals
Free forex signals come in various forms, each catering to different trader preferences and needs. Manual signals rely on the expertise of seasoned traders who analyze market trends and share their trade ideas, providing valuable insights but often limited by human capacity. Automated signals, generated by sophisticated algorithms, offer speed and the ability to process vast amounts of data, though they may miss subtle market nuances. Social and copy trading signals leverage community knowledge by allowing traders to follow and replicate the trades of experienced investors, offering a practical way to learn and potentially profit.
Manual Signals from Experts
Experienced traders generate forex signals by analyzing technical indicators, news, and price patterns. They share alerts via Telegram, email, or apps, including entry price, stop-loss, and take-profit levels. Explanations help followers understand the reasoning behind each signal forex, promoting informed trading decisions.
Automated Signals via Software
Automated systems use algorithms to scan markets and generate alerts based on technical indicators or price patterns. These trading signals offer speed and can process vast data but may lack the nuance of human judgment. While automation ensures round-the-clock market monitoring and rapid alert generation, it may sometimes produce false alerts during volatile or unpredictable market conditions. Therefore, combining automated alerts with human analysis often yields the best outcomes, especially in fast-paced markets like binary options.
Social and Copy Trading Signals
Social trading platforms allow traders to follow and replicate trades of successful investors in real time. These binary options signals come directly from experienced traders, providing transparency into their strategies and performance. Community feedback and ratings help users evaluate the reliability of signal providers, fostering trust and collaboration. For beginners, social trading offers a hands-on learning experience, enabling them to observe expert decision-making and potentially profit by mirroring their trades.
How to Use Free Forex Signals Effectively
To use free forex signals effectively, treat them as helpful tools rather than guarantees. Always confirm the alert by performing your own technical or fundamental analysis before executing a trade. Timing is critical—act promptly to avoid missing important market moves. Additionally, apply strict risk management by setting stop-loss levels and controlling trade sizes to safeguard your capital while following alerts.
Timing Your Trades with Signals
Acting quickly on signals is critical because forex trading markets move fast. Ensure your forex broker supports instant order execution to avoid slippage and missed opportunities.
Combining Signals with Your Own Analysis
Don’t rely solely on signals; integrate them with your technical and fundamental analysis. This hybrid approach increases confidence and reduces risks associated with blind following. Trade Forex by combining indicator Forex strategies with the insights provided by alerts.
Managing Risks When Following Signals
Always apply proper risk management, including setting stop-loss orders and limiting position sizes. Treat forex signals as guides, not guarantees, and avoid risking large portions of your capital on single trades.
Where to Find Reliable Free Forex Signals
Reliable signals can be found through reputable forex forums, well-known trading communities, and brokers offering free services as part of their educational resources. Vet signal providers by checking user reviews, performance records, and transparency in communication.
Pros and Cons of Using Free Forex Signals
Pros include cost savings, learning opportunities, and access to diverse trading ideas. Cons involve variable quality, potential delays, and the risk of over-reliance without personal strategy development.
How to Evaluate the Quality of Free Forex Signals
Look for signals with clear entry and exit points, logical explanations, and consistent performance. Transparency about past results and real-time updates are also indicators of trustworthy providers.
